Qualifications Required:

1. education degree and a Master of Counselling Psychology degree or a related discipline with a focus on counselling including a university course in level B assessments, theory, and practice;

2. a minimum of 3 years recent successful experience in school counselling including student, family, and community counselling;

3. knowledge of First Nations cultures, histories, traditions, and ways of learning;

4. ability to:

  • recognize and determine factors which may precipitate problems for students and seek solutions;
  • facilitate the goals of career education by assisting students and their families to explore and clarify the student's career options through developmental activities that stress decision-making, personal planning, transition planning, and career awareness;
  • build trust, foster belonging, and support students through culturally grounded approaches;

5. knowledge of current 21st century pedagogy and assessment practices;

6. demonstrated ability to work effectively in a team environment and contribute to the professional community at the school and district level;

7. effective communication, interpersonal, organizational and classroom management skills;

8. ability to integrate technologies and digital citizenship into educational programs; and

9. BC Professional Teaching Certificate and current eligibility for Teacher Qualification Service card.
